To compare the mean and median for the characteristics of taking every score into account, being affected by extreme scores, and their advantages, we can observe the following:

1. Take every score into account:
- The mean considers every score in the dataset when calculating the central tendency. Each score contributes equally to the mean.
- On the other hand, the median only considers the middle value in the dataset. It does not take into account every score.

2. Affected by extreme scores:
- The mean is highly influenced by extreme scores since it incorporates all the values. Even a single extreme score can significantly impact the mean.
- In contrast, the median is not significantly affected by extreme scores. It only considers the middle value and is less influenced by outliers.

3. Advantages:
- The mean provides a comprehensive summary of the data since it considers all the values. It is useful when the dataset is normally distributed and has no extreme outliers.
- The median is advantageous when the dataset has extreme values or a skewed distribution. It is a more robust measure of central tendency compared to the mean, as it is not heavily influenced by outliers.

In summary, the mean takes every score into account but is sensitive to extreme values, while the median only considers the middle value and is less affected by outliers. The advantage of the mean lies in its inclusivity of all data points, while the advantage of the median lies in its resilience to extreme scores.
